Anteckning
Åtkomst till den här sidan kräver auktorisering. Du kan prova att logga in eller ändra kataloger.
Åtkomst till den här sidan kräver auktorisering. Du kan prova att ändra kataloger.
I följande tabell sammanfattas lagringen som är associerad med varje grundläggande typ.
Storlekar på grundläggande typer
| Typ | Förvaring | 
|---|---|
              char, , unsigned charsigned char | 
1 byte | 
              short, unsigned short | 
2 byte | 
              int, unsigned int | 
4 byte | 
              long, unsigned long | 
4 byte | 
              long long, unsigned long long | 
8 byte | 
float | 
4 byte | 
double | 
8 byte | 
long double | 
8 byte | 
C-datatyperna delas in i allmänna kategorier. De integrerade typerna är int, char, short, longoch long long. Dessa typer kan kvalificeras med signed eller unsigned, och unsigned kan användas som förkortning för unsigned int. Uppräkningstyper (enum) behandlas också som integraltyper för de flesta ändamål. De flytande typerna är float, doubleoch long double. De aritmetiska typerna innehåller alla flytande och integrerade typer.